How To Set Up eHub Pack
eHub Pack selects the best package for an order based on item dimensions, quantity, and the packages you configure. Once set up, Pack can automatically assign package types during order processing.

Step 1: Configure Your Products for Pack
Pack uses product dimensions to determine which package should be used.
- Navigate to Inventory > Active Products.
- Open the product you want to configure.
- Scroll to Item Dimensions and enter the product's length, width, and height.
- The Pack checkbox is enabled by default. Uncheck it if you do not want Pack to consider this product when determining packages.
- Enable Eligible for Softpack if desired.
- Add different fulfillment dims if desired (e.g., if the product requires special packaging).
- Click Save Changes.
Example settings:
- Use Item Dimensions if the product ships at its actual size.
- Enter Packed Dimensions if the packed size is different.
- Enable Eligible for Softpack if the item can ship in a poly bag.

Step 2: Configure Your Packages
Pack selects from the packages defined in your settings.
- Go to Settings > Packages.
- Click + New Package or open an existing package.
- Enter the Package Name.
- Select the Package Type (Box, Soft Pack, etc.).
- Enter the external dimensions.
- Add package weight if needed.
- Add Maximum Weight if desired. (Entering maximum weight will prevent the system from packing the package over the maximum weight.)
- Click Save.

Step 3: Create an Automation to Run Pack
Automations determine when Pack runs on an order.
- Go to Settings > Automations.
- Click + New Automation.
- Set the conditions for the automation.
- Under Actions, click + New Action.
- Select Assign Package Type.
- Choose eHub Pack from the dropdown.
- Click Save.

Step 4: Review Pack Results
To review an order:
- Navigate to Ship.
- Open an order.
- Review the Package Type, Dimensions, and Weight assigned by Pack.

Step 5: Save Pack Overrides
If you change the package type on an order, you can save that change so Pack remembers it.
- Change the Package Type on the order.
- Click Remember this Option? when prompted.
- Choose how the override should apply (same SKUs or dimensions).
- Click Save to Pack.

Saved overrides can be viewed in Settings > Pack.
